CRC Energy Efficiency Scheme

What is CRC?

The CRC Energy Efficiency Scheme is a mandatory emissions trading scheme that was introduced in April 2010.

Who will it affect?

It will affect all organisations whose electricity consumption through their half hourly metered supplies (including AMR meters) exceeded 6,000 MWh/year (£400,000 to £600,000) in the year ending December 2008, and will include all energy except transport fuels.

How does it work?

  • Each participant will have base year (‘Footprint Year) which is April 2010 until March 2011
  • The annual carbon reduction performance will be compared against this.
  • Participants will have to purchase Allowances, the first being 2012
